| Sumario: | Throughout the present work, we extend the study of Zinbiel algebras to Zinbiel superalgebras. In particular, we show that all Zinbiel superalgebras over an arbitrary field are nilpotent in the same way as occurs for Zinbiel algebras. In addition, and since the most important cases of nilpotent algebras or superalgebras are those with maximal nilpotency index, we study the complex null-filiform Zinbiel superalgebra proving that it is unique up to isomorphism. After that, we characterize the naturally graded filiform ones and obtain low-dimensional classifications. |
